In June 2012, for example, the global price for flat steel has decreased due to weakening demand.
Having remained uncertain about future market trends, buyers were reluctant to purchase large volumes of material.
As a result, mill delivery lead times shortened.
Customers in all regions are likely to restrict purchase volumes in a bid to keep inventories low over the coming months.
A slowing economic recovery in most countries will, almost certainly, restrict consumption of steel products.
Consequently, transaction values are forecast to fall further in the short term.
Reductions in input expenditure are anticipated and likely to add to the downward price pressure during the second half of the year.
Analysts predict that prices will recover at the end of 2012 because distributors are likely to begin placing orders for delivery in the New Year.
In the first quarter of 2013, the cost of raw materials costs is most likely to rise as new capacity installations come on stream to meet expectations of higher end-user demand.
